Part Details
- Single positive supply (self biased) typical: 1.5 V and 35 mA
- RBIAS drain current adjustment pin
- Gain: 28.5 dB from 8 GHz to 10 GHz
- Noise figure: 1 dB from 8 GHz to 10 GHz
- Extended operating temperature range: −55°C to +125°C
- Internally matched and AC-coupled
- RoHS-compliant, 2 mm × 2 mm, 8-lead LFCSP
The ADL8143 is a low noise amplifier (LNA) that operates from 8 GHz to 14 GHz. The typical gain, noise figure, output power for 1 dB compression (OP1dB), and output third-order intercept (OIP3) are 28.5 dB, 1 dB, 7.5 dBm, and 19.5 dBm, respectively, from 8 GHz to 10 GHz. The nominal quiescent current (IDQ), which can be adjusted, is 35 mA from a 1.5 V supply voltage (VDD). The ADL8143 also features inputs and outputs that are AC-coupled and internally matched to 50 Ω.
The ADL8143 is housed in an RoHS-compliant, 2 mm × 2 mm, 8-lead lead frame chip scale package [LFCSP] and is specified for operation from −55°C to +125°C.
